Honoring our Military Men & Women

Today, and everyday, Ashmore and Ashmore salutes our military men and women- those that have served before and now.

We are devastated to hear of the young men and women who gave their lives last Thursday in Afghanistan, and our prayers are with their friends and family. We grieve with our great nation, and recognize the sacrifice these men and women made for us all.


Let us take a minute to read the names of our fallen heroes:

  • Marine Corps Lance Cpl. David L. Espinoza, 20, of Rio Bravo, Texas

  • Marine Corps Sgt. Nicole L. Gee, 23, of Sacramento, California

  • Marine Corps Staff Sgt. Darin T. Hoover, 31, of Salt Lake City, Utah

  • U.S. Army Staff Sgt. Ryan C. Knauss, 23, of Corryton, Tennessee

  • Marine Corps Cpl. Hunter Lopez, 22, of Indio, California

  • Marine Corps Lance Cpl. Rylee J. McCollum, 20, Jackson, Wyoming

  • Marine Corps Lance Cpl. Dylan R. Merola, 20, of Rancho Cucamonga, California

  • Marine Corps Lance Cpl. Kareem M. Nikoui, 20, of Norco, California

  • Marine Corps Cpl. Daegan W. Page, 23, of Omaha, Nebraska

  • Marine Corps Sgt. Johanny Rosariopichardo, 25, of Lawrence, Massachusetts

  • Marine Corps Cpl. Humberto A. Sanchez, 22, of Logansport, Indiana

  • Marine Corps Lance Cpl. Jared M. Schmitz, 20, of St. Charles, Missouri

  • Navy Hospitalman Maxton W. Soviak, 22, of Berlin Heights, Ohio

Thank you for your service and sacrifice. You will not be forgotten.
